What is Accident Injury Lawsuit Representation?
Accident injury lawsuit representation refers to the legal support supplied by accident lawyers to individuals who have actually sustained injuries due to the carelessness of another party. These lawyers assist customers through the legal procedure, helping them to file a lawsuit, work out settlements, and, if essential, represent them in court.
The Role of a Personal Injury Attorney
A personal injury attorney serves several vital functions in an accident injury lawsuit:

Comprehending the lawsuit process is essential for anybody considering legal action after an Accident Legal Counsel. Here's a detailed guide:
1. Assessment
The primary step is talking to a personal injury attorney. This preliminary conference frequently includes a conversation of the accident, medical records, and any associated proof.
2. Examination
The attorney conducts a thorough investigation. They collect proof, including cops reports, medical records, and witness declarations.
3. Suing
If there is a valid case, the attorney submits a formal claim with the responsible party's insurance provider, detailing the basis for the claim and the compensation sought.
4. Settlement
The insurer will usually react with a preliminary offer. The attorney will work out in your place to protect a reasonable settlement.
5. Lawsuit Filing
If negotiations stop working, the attorney can file a lawsuit in court. This moves the case into the legal system where formal procedures will be followed.
6. Discovery Phase
Both celebrations engage in discovery, exchanging proof and details appropriate to the case.
7. Trial
If a settlement is still not reached, the case goes to trial where both parties provide their arguments, and a judge or jury makes a decision.
8. Settlement or Judgment
After the trial, the court provides a judgment. If successful, the complainant receives compensation as granted.
Often Asked Questions (FAQs)Q1: How much does it cost to hire an accident lawyer?
A lot of injury attorneys work on a contingency charge basis, indicating they just earn money if you win the case. The common cost varieties in between 25% to 40% of the compensation awarded.
Q2: How long do I need to submit a lawsuit?
Statutes of constraints vary by state but usually vary from one to three years from the date of the injury. It's vital to speak with an attorney without delay to ensure your case is submitted within the time limitations.
Q3: What if I was partly at fault for the accident?
Numerous states follow comparative neglect laws, which allow you to recover damages even if you are partly at fault. However, your compensation might be decreased based upon your percentage of fault.
Q4: What kinds of damages can I claim?
You can claim different types of damages, consisting of:
